The way that Envy and Wrath scene is shot is brilliant. At first, John Doe is shown so that the power lines tower above him. Once Somerset opens the box, the camera angle changes so that the power lines are dwarfed by him and the sun is directly behind his head, signifying that despite him being in handcuffs, John Doe has the power.
